Producer Members
Companies who manufacture concrete masonry units including; concrete block, concrete pavers, concrete segmental retaining walls. (Voting Membership)
Associate Members
Companies who are manufacturers and suppliers of equipment, aggregate, admixtures, cement, paint or other manufacturers and suppliers interested in the welfare of the concrete masonry industry. (Voting Membership)
Allied Members
Open to all architects, engineers and mason contractors interested in the welfare of the masonry industry.
(Non-voting Membership)
Proud Affiliate of NCMA (National Concrete Masonry Association)
The Indiana Concrete Masonry Association is made up of companies dedicated to
promoting masonry construction in and around the state of Indiana.
The Indiana Concrete Masonry Association works through committees that support the concrete masonry construction industry statewide. Within those committees there are sub committees tackling the most important issues of our time. Other activities of ICMA include college student tours, architect and engineer education, safety seminars, masonry awards program, sales seminars, production seminars, promotional mailings, and the list grows every year. ICMA Annual Events:
ICMA hosts three major meetings for the membership throughout the year. The
Annual Meeting, Summer Meeting and Fall Meeting are designed to educate the
membership on masonry topics along with educational sessions for architects and
engineers. The meetings incorporate structured educational sessions with
opportunities to network within the membership at social functions.
ICMA enjoys a relationship with Ball State University and Notre Dame
University hosting for the third decade a masonry design program for the
sophomore students. This program is a mainstay for the architectural curriculum
of both schools.
ICMA has members and staff certified to teach the National Concrete Masonry
Association’s Segmental Retaining Wall Installation program. This class
certifies installers nationwide for installation of both gravity and engineered
wall systems.
Each year ICMA hosts the Excellence in Masonry Awards program. Architects,
Owners and Mason Contractors are celebrated for their design and installation of
masonry products.
ICMA also is an AIA provider educating designers throughout Indiana. Members of
ICMA can take advantage of these programs by hosting events either at their
office or at a meeting facility.
